Recall - Reprogram PCM: Overview
No. 7582May, 1998
To: All Dodge and Chrysler-Plymouth Dealers
Subject:
Emissions Recalls # 7581 and # 7582-- Reprogram Powertrain Control Module
Models:
1996 Model Year Chrysler Cirrus, Dodge Stratus and Plymouth Breeze (JA); and Chrysler Sebring Convertible (JX) Vehicles Equipped With a 2.4L Engine ("X" in the 8th VIN Position) and:
^ a Federal Emission Control System (Sales Code -- NAA) -- Recall # 7581
^ a California Emission Control System (Sales Code -- NAE) -- Recall # 7582
The Powertrain Control Module (PCM) on about 100,000 of the above listed vehicles, may fail to maintain adequate emission control when the vehicle is operated under load at a steady speed. To correct this condition, the PCM must be reprogrammed (flashed).
IMPORTANT:
This recall (# 7582) is subject to the State of California Registration Renewal/Emissions Recall Enforcement Program. Involved vehicles must have the recall service completed before registration renewal.
The servicing dealer must provide a Vehicle Emission Recall Proof of Correction Form (Form No. 81-016-1053) to each California vehicle owner upon completion of the Recall # 7582 service, for use as proof in renewal of the vehicle registration.
Dealer Notification & Vehicle List
All dealers will receive a copy of this dealer recall notification letter by first class mail. Each dealer to whom involved vehicles were invoiced (or the current dealer at the same street address) will receive a list of their involved vehicles. The Vehicle List is arranged in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) sequence. Owners known to Chrysler are also listed. The lists are for dealer reference in arranging for service of involved vehicles.
DIAL System Functions 53 and VIP
All involved vehicles will be entered to DIAL System Functions 53 and VIP at the time of recall implementation for dealer inquiry as needed.
Function 53 provides involved dealers with an updated VIN list of incomplete vehicles. The customer name, address and phone number is listed if known. Completed vehicles are removed from Function 53 within several days of repair claim submission. To use this system, type 53" at the "ENTER FUNCTION" prompt, then type "ORD7581"(Federal emission vehicles) or "ORD7582" (California emission vehicles).
Parts
Important:
A quantity of labels will be distributed initially and billed to all involved dealers. This quantity will cover a portion of the total vehicles involved. Additional labels may be ordered as needed to support scheduled repairs.
Each involved dealer, to whom vehicles in the recall were invoiced, (or the current dealer at the same street address) will receive enough Authorized Software Update labels and Authorized Modifications labels to service about 25% of those vehicles. Each vehicle requires application of an Authorized Software Update label, PN 04669020, and an Authorized Modifications label, PN 04275086.
Owner Notification and Service Scheduling
All involved vehicle owners known to Chrysler are being notified of the service requirement by first class mail. They are requested to schedule appointments for this service with their dealers. A copy of the owner notification letter is included.
Enclosed with each owner notification is an Owner Notification Form. The involved vehicle and recall are identified on the form for owner or dealer reference as needed.
